WebbCovalent bonds meanwhile usually occur between non-metals. As long as the individual atoms can form an octet of electrons from sharing electrons in a covalent bond, there's always a possibility. So nitrogen for example is a non-metal with 5 valence electrons and needs 3 more for an octet, and can form a variety of covalent bonds. WebbA covalent bond is a chemical bond that involves the sharing of electrons to form electron pairs between atoms. WebbThe shared electrons split their time between the valence shells of the hydrogen and oxygen atoms, giving each atom something resembling a complete valence shell (two electrons for H, eight for O). WebbWhen complete transfer occurs, the bonding is ionic. When electrons are merely shared, the bonding is covalent, and each shared electron pair constitutes one chemical bond. Such is the basis of the theory of chemical bonding that is still widely held. There is much to explain and more to understand, however, and there are many important ...
